DAA-opetusohjelma: Suunnittelu ja analyysi Algorithms

DAA opetusohjelman yhteenveto

Tämä suunnittelu ja analyysi Algorithms Opetusohjelma on suunniteltu aloittelijoille, joilla on vähän tai ei ollenkaan koodauskokemusta. Se kattaa algoritmien suunnittelun ja analyysin prosessikonseptit.

Mikä on algoritmi?

Algoritmi on joukko hyvin määriteltyjä ohjeita, jotka on suunniteltu suorittamaan tietty joukko tehtäviä. Algorithms Niitä käytetään tietojenkäsittelytieteessä laskelmien, automaattisen päättelyn, tietojenkäsittelyn, laskennan ja ongelmanratkaisun suorittamiseen. Algoritmin suunnittelu on tärkeää ennen ohjelmakoodin kirjoittamista, koska algoritmi selittää logiikan jo ennen koodin kehittämistä.

DAA opetusohjelma

esittely

👍 Lesson 1 Ahne algoritmi — Ahne menetelmä ja lähestymistapa esimerkein
👍 Lesson 2 Pyöreä linkitetty luettelo — Edut C-ohjelmaesimerkillä
👍 Lesson 3 Joukko tietorakenteissa — Mikä on, käsite, lisää/poista OperaTIONS

Edistynyttä tavaraa

👍 Lesson 1 B PUU tietorakenteessa — Hae, Lisää, Poista Operaesimerkki
👍 Lesson 2 B+ PUU — Etsi, lisää ja poista Operaesimerkki
👍 Lesson 3 Leveys ensin -hakualgoritmi – Opi esimerkin avulla
👍 Lesson 4 Binaarinen hakupuu – Opi esimerkin avulla
👍 Lesson 5 Binäärihakualgoritmi – Opi esimerkin avulla
👍 Lesson 6 Lineaarinen haku — Lineaarinen haku: Python, C++ esimerkki
👍 Lesson 7 Bubble Lajittelualgoritmi – Opi kanssa Python käyttämällä List Esimerkkiä
👍 Lesson 8 Valinta Lajittele - Algoritmi selitetty Python Koodiesimerkki
👍 Lesson 9 Heap Lajittelu Algoritmi - C++, Python Esimerkit
👍 Lesson 10 Hash-taulukko tietorakenteessa – Opi kanssa Python esimerkki
👍 Lesson 11 Tree Traversals — Tree Traversals (järjestys, ennakkotilaus, jälkitilaus): C, Python, C++ Esimerkit
👍 Lesson 12 Binaarinen puu — Binääripuu tietorakenteessa (ESIMERKKI)
👍 Lesson 13 Yhdistelmäalgoritmi — Tulosta kaikki mahdolliset R |:n yhdistelmät C,C++,Python esimerkki
👍 Lesson 14 Pisin yleinen seuraus — Pisin yhteinen jakso: Python, C++ esimerkki
👍 Lesson 15 Dijsktran algoritmi - Dijsktran algoritmi: C++, Python Koodiesimerkki
👍 Lesson 16 Kadencen algoritmi — Kadencen algoritmi: Suurin Summa Contiguous Subarray
👍 Lesson 17 Radix-lajittelualgoritmi — Radix-lajittelualgoritmi: C++, Python Esimerkit
👍 Lesson 18 Kaksoislinkitetty lista - Kaksoislinkitetty luettelo: C++, Python esimerkki
👍 Lesson 19 Yksittäin linkitetty luettelo - Yksittäin linkitetty luettelo: C++, Python esimerkki
👍 Lesson 20 Prime Factor -algoritmi - C, Python esimerkki
👍 Lesson 21 Topologinen lajittelu - Python, C++ Algoritmi esimerkki
👍 Lesson 22 Kaavioiden tyypit — Kaaviotyypit ja esimerkkejä
👍 Lesson 23 Kaavion tietorakenne - Graafinen tietorakenne ja Algorithms
👍 Lesson 24 Adjacency-luettelo — Graafin vierekkäisyysluettelo ja matriisiesitys
👍 Lesson 25 Hanoin torni - Hanoin torni -algoritmi: Python, C++ Koodi
👍 Lesson 26 Matkustavan myyjän ongelma - matkustava myyjä -ongelma: Python, C++ algoritmi
👍 Lesson 27 Eratosthenes-algoritmin seula — Eratosthenes-algoritmin seula: Python, C++ esimerkki
👍 Lesson 28 Pascalin kolmio – Kaava, mallit ja esimerkit
👍 Lesson 29 Lisäyslajittelu - Algoritmi C:llä, C++, Java, Python Esimerkit
👍 Lesson 30 taikaneliönä - Ratkaise 3 × 3 palapeli C & Python Esimerkit
👍 Lesson 31 Keon tietorakenne – Mikä on Heap? Min & Max Heap (esimerkki)
👍 Lesson 32 Mikä on puolitusmenetelmä – Esimerkkejä puolitusmenetelmästä C++, Python
👍 Lesson 33 Shell-lajittelualgoritmi – Shell-lajittelualgoritmi EXAMPLE:n avulla
👍 Lesson 34 Kauhan lajittelualgoritmi - Java, Python, C/C++ Koodiesimerkit
👍 Lesson 35 Peruutusalgoritmi - Mikä on paluualgoritmi?

Täytyy tietää!

👍 Lesson 1 BFS vs DFS - Mitä eroa?
👍 Lesson 2 AVL puut — Kierrokset, lisäys, poisto C++ esimerkki
👍 Lesson 3 PARHAAT tietorakenteet ja Algorithms Kurssit — 8 PARHAAT tietorakennetta ja Algorithms Kurssit
👍 Lesson 4 Parhaat algoritmihaastattelukysymykset — 18 suosituinta algoritmihaastattelun kysymystä ja vastausta
👍 Lesson 5 DAA opetusohjelma PDF — Suunnittelu ja analyysi Algorithms

Miksi algoritmien suunnittelua ja analyysiä kannattaa tutkia?

Algoritmien suunnittelu ja analyysi auttavat suunnittelemaan algoritmeja tietojenkäsittelytieteen erilaisten ongelmien ratkaisemiseen. Se auttaa myös suunnittelemaan ja analysoimaan ohjelman toimintalogiikkaa ennen varsinaisen koodin kehittämistä ohjelmalle.

Edellytykset oppia DAA Tutorial

Jotta voit oppia tämän DAA-opetusohjelman, sinun pitäisi tietää perusohjelmointi ja matematiikan käsitteet ja tietorakenteen käsitteet. Algoritmien perustiedot auttavat myös oppimaan ja ymmärtämään DAA-käsitteitä helposti ja nopeasti.

Mitä opit tässä suunnittelussa ja analyysissä Algorithms Opetusohjelma?

Tässä suunnittelussa ja analyysissä Algorithms opetusohjelmassa opit DAA:n peruskäsitteet, kuten johdannon algoritmiin, ahneeseen algoritmiin, linkitettyyn luetteloon ja tietorakenteen taulukoihin. Opit myös edistyneitä käsitteitä, kuten puut tietorakenteessa, hakualgoritmit, lajittelualgoritmit, hash-taulukot ja haastattelukysymykset liittyen Algorithms.

Päivittäinen Guru99-uutiskirje

Aloita päiväsi uusimmilla ja tärkeimmillä tekoälyuutisilla, jotka toimitetaan juuri nyt.